Job Description
The Department of Agricultural and Applied Economics seeks to hire a responsible and creative Graduate Program Professional Coordinator. This individual will work independently to administer and manage the Departments graduate programs and provide selected support activities under the supervision of the Graduate Director and the Department Head. Responsibilities of this position will include but are not limited to: Assisting in recruiting prospective students and advising current students on departmental programs (41 Online MS Traditional MS PhD and graduate certificates) providing academic information and initial advising managing applications assistantship awards and course registrations; Promote recruit and advise for the departmental 41 and Graduate Dual enrollment programs within the department and beyond; Providing student support services for the graduate program including progress reports plans of study student outcome assessments graduate student office space and HR administration of graduate student employment including assistantship agreements; Serve as the departments primary point-of-contact with the Graduate School to ensure policy compliance and strategic alignment; Assist faculty in the department in managing the college and university governance process when creating new graduate courses graduate certificates etc.; The ability to assist faculty in identifying internal funding sources for graduate students;
Work with the Communications Manager in the development of marketing and recruitment materials through all appropriate outlets (e.g. website social media department screens power points flyers etc.) assisting with development and maintenance of an AAEC graduate alumni database for the purpose of follow-up contact highlighting the achievements of alumni and alumni engagement in general.
Serve on various committees to support the departments development improvement; Maintain Departmental key inventory and distribute keys appropriately; Providing redundancy with the Assistant Director for Business Operations to cover key responsibilities when this person is unavailable such as new hire paperwork and Banner transactions; Maintaining and enhancing personal knowledge of relevant software such as Word Excel PowerPoint access Adobe Acrobat banner Hokie spa Submittable and others.
Required Qualifications
Bachelors degree; or equivalent applicable experience or training; Strong organizational skills and attention to detail; Excellent oral and written communication skills; Ability to effectively represent and market the graduate program in different settings including website social media and through personal contacts and presentations; Strong people skills and expertise in quickly building rapport with students faculty and the campus community; Ability to work comfortably and respectfully with all individuals in a diverse multicultural environment.
Preferred Qualifications
Masters degree in agriculture and applied economics or related discipline student support or advising experience. Familiarity and understanding necessary to work effectively with various campus units; Familiarity with Virginia Tech systems in general but especially Banner and Slate but not limited to these; Familiarity with university travel policies and procedures.

About Virginia Tech
Dedicated to its mottoUt Prosim(That I May Serve) Virginia Tech pushes the boundaries of knowledge by taking a hands-on transdisciplinary approach to preparing scholars to be leaders and problem-solvers. A comprehensive land-grant institution that enhances the quality of life in Virginia and throughout the world Virginia Tech is aninclusive communitydedicated to knowledge discovery and creativity. The university offers more than 280 majors to a diverse enrollment of more than 36000 undergraduate graduate and professional students in eightundergraduate colleges aschool of medicine aveterinary medicinecollegeGraduate School andHonors university has a significant presence across Virginia including Blacksburg the greater Washington D.C. area the Health Sciences and Technology Campus in Roanoke sites in Newport News and Richmond and numerousExtension officesandresearch institutes.A leading global research institution Virginia Tech conducts more than $650 million in research annually.
